Abstract
In this paper, we obtain a complete description of the class of n-tuples (n >= 2) of doubly commuting isometries. In particular, we present a several variables analogue of the Wold decomposition for isometries on Hilbert spaces. Our main result is a generalization of M. Slocinski's Wold-type decomposition of a pair of doubly commuting isometries.
